Previous Table of Contents Next


16.6.3 Basic Location Algorithm


   ORB clients can use the following algorithm to locate the server capable of handling the invoke RPC for a particular operation:

   Any invoke RPC might return INVOKE_LOCATION_FORWARD, in which case the client ORB should make the returned profile the current profile, and re-enter the location algorithm at step 2.

   If an RPC on a binding handle fails after it has been used successfully, the client ORB should start over at step 1.